A typical photovoltaic panel is primarily composed of glass, silicone sheets, aluminum frames, and batteries, all of which can be reused. Scraped photovoltaic panels are sorted and disassembled. The waste photovoltaic panel processing process: Scrapped panels are shredded in a shredder. The shredded material then enters a specialized crusher, breaking up the EVA film and monocrystalline silicon wafers. The shredded material is then fed into a collector via an induced draft fan, where it undergoes sorting to separate the silicon. The remaining mixed material then enters a specialized pulverizer, passes through an air lock, and enters an airflow separator. Airflow and vibration combine to collect positive metals and plastics, while also collecting the dust generated by the separator.
